Artisanal and small-scale gold mining (ASGM) is the largest global source of anthropogenic mercury emissions. It is prevalent in over eighty countries and uses mercury to extract gold from ore. This process clears forests, dredges rivers, and creates mining ponds. Mercury – a potent neurotoxin – is released into surrounding ecosystems through atmospheric deposition and contaminated tailings. Despite the scale of this contamination, we know little about how this mercury cycles through aquatic and terrestrial ecosystems.
In this presentation, Gerson examines mercury inputs, transport, and transformation into the toxic, bioavailable form methylmercury across ecosystems affected by ASGM. She draws on research conducted in aquatic and terrestrial ecosystems in the Peruvian Amazon, agro-ecosystems in Ghana, and solutions-oriented approaches in Senegal. Findings raise important questions about the risks ASGM-derived mercury poses to aquatic and terrestrial food webs, and to the indigenous and rural communities and wildlife that depend on them.
